In a meeting with Iranian military commanders on Sunday, Iran's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ei praised the country's armed forces for their "success in recent events," referring to the unprecedented direct attack on Israel launched from Iranian territory last week.

During the attack, missiles and drones were launched at Israel, but most of them were intercepted and shot down by Israel and its allies. As a result, the damage inflicted on Israel was relatively modest. However, Khamenei emphasized that the primary focus should not be on the number of missiles launched or their accuracy, but rather on the demonstration of Iran's power during the operation.

Khamenei lauded the armed forces' ability to minimize costs and maximize gains during the attack. He urged military officials to continually pursue military innovation and to familiarize themselves with the tactics employed by the enemy.

The Iranian Supreme Leader emphasized that debates about the exact number of missiles launched or their impact were of secondary importance. During his remarks, which were broadcasted by state television, Khamenei highlighted the need for unity and emphasized the significance of Iran's show of strength.

The meeting was attended by the top ranks of Iran's regular military, police, and the powerful paramilitary Islamic Revolutionary Guards Corps (IRGC), showcasing the united front presented by Iran's military and security forces.

The attack unleashed by Iran was in response to what was suspected to be an Israeli strike on the Iranian consulate in Damascus, Syria, on April 1. The Iranian consulate attack resulted in the death of two IRGC generals, among others.

Notably, Khamenei's comments did not address the apparent Israeli retaliatory strike on the central city of Isfahan on Friday. Although Iran's air defenses were activated, and commercial flights were grounded across a significant portion of the country, the Supreme Leader opted not to discuss this incident.
